The Center for Healing within Cooper University Health Care is a leading Addiction Medicine provider within Camden County and Southern New role will supporttheworkof theCenter for Healing by supporting grant-funded programswith the goal ofexpandingaccess toevidence-basedcare andsupports. Day to day activities include:
- Managingongoingprojectsandnew initiativeswithin theCenter for Healingsprogram portfolio of varying degrees of complexity frominceptionto successful completion.
- Ensuring grant deliverables are met according to funder contracts.
- Workingwith stakeholders and community partnerstoenhance collaborative successful delivery of services andfacilitateeducation mentoring collaboration and networking.
- Working with dataanalystto develop data collectionprocesses and ensure the submission oftimelyandaccuratereports to funding agencies.
- Schedulingcoordinatingandfacilitatingtrainingsrelated to grant funded programs.
- Trackingallgrant relatedexpendituresandmonitoringthe use of grant funds against the approvedproject budget.
- Identifyingand sourcing potentialgrant revenue opportunities thatmatch the goals ofthe Center for Healing.
- Preparinggrant applications and proposals for submission to government foundationandcorporate entities.
- Managingspecial projectsincludingdevelopmentof newprojects.
- Will lead workoftheirprojects andmay supervise staffworking on specific grants within their portfolio.
The current projects focus on health and housing initiatives overdose preventiontoxicosurveillancelow-barrier treatment forindividuals who are unhoused low-barrier Hep C treatment and HIV prevention and complex in any or several of these areaspreferred.
